Logistics Automation Market Overview:

Logistics automation refers to the use of technology like machinery and logistics software to improve the efficiency of logistical processes from procurement to production, inventory management, distribution, customer service, and recovery. On the machinery side, think of automatic guided vehicles, robotic arms, and automated storage & retrieval systems (AS/RS) like carousels and vertical lift modules. And on the logistics software side, many solutions help with sales, WMS, CRM, billing, accounting, tracking, business intelligence, and more. Logistics automation involves the use of technologies that boost warehouse efficiency. Processes that can be automated range from goods receipt and order fulfillment to stock control and order dispatch. COVID-19 Impact on Global Logistics Automation Market: The COVID-19 pandemic had adverse effect on the Global Logistics Automation Market due to the government restrictions such as lockdown and social distancing which are imposed during the pandemic. COVID-19 has significantly disrupted the revenue of several industries including infrastructure, retail, manufacturing, automotive, logistics, and others. For instance, according to the International Finance Corporation, the logistics firms involved in the movement, storage, and flow of goods were severely get impacted due to COVID–19. Moreover, many countries such as India, UK have put strict lockdown across the country, which restrains the movement of people as well as goods, across the national and international borders. This negatively impacts the revenue of logistics companies, and in turn hampers the adoption of advanced technologies across the logistics sector.

Now-a-days the enterprises are adopting cloud-based logistics automation tools for face security and privacy issues. To avoid data breaches and theft, the enterprises possess confidential data which will also affect the reputation of enterprises on the whole. The enterprises’ data may leak over the internet and can be accessed by unauthorized users, which is a growing concern among enterprises. For instance, the cloud-based transportation management system needs multitenant architecture, wherein a single version of the software runs on a server that is shared by multiple customers. Hence, there is a possibility that subscribers of an enterprise can view the data of competitors. These security issues relating to the data access by unauthorized users will likely threaten the enterprise data security and competitive business position, as well. Hence, these issues relating to security and privacy increase the growing concerns among enterprises. This is the main challenge which is faced by the global logistics automation market.

Based on component, The hardware-integrated systems segment is expected to hold the highest market share during the forecast period because of the rising demand for robotics and automation technology worldwide for food and beverage companies. The hardware-integrated systems segment include Automated Storage and Retrieval System (ASRS), conveyors and sortation systems, robotic handling systems, Autonomous Mobile Robots (AMRs), and Automated Guided Vehicles (AGVs). As, robots are increasingly being deployed across all segments of the supply chain, and their usage is expected to witness a significant surge in the near future and is expected to drive the market. In 2022, RMGroup’s soft drinks producer Radnor Hills has installed three ABB end-of-line robotic palletizers robotics integrator for operating logistics operations of the company.
